Shibarium, a layer-2 solution suggested by Shiba Inu developer Ryoshi, would host the Shiba ecosystem to support the network’s growing functionality. Since Shiba relies on Ethereum, high gas prices have suffocated consumers, particularly when Shiboshi NFTs launched. Despite Ethereum’s switch to proof-of-stake, this issue persists.
Shibarium will use a sophisticated mechanism to burn SHIB tokens, lowering the quantity of coins in circulation, which should boost the price. Shibarium might potentially connect different ecosystems and let developers build on it. Unification developers are establishing a Testnet to create end-user products including wallets, block explorers, and token transfer bridges.
